The Kodak Instamatic 92 is a fixed-focus camera for 110 film. It has a sliding lens cover. It is a fixed-exposure model, which used magicubes for indoor photography.[1] But while 110 film survives as a niche format, magicubes haven't been made for years.
It was produced between 1974 - 1976.
